Deskripsi

Potassium citrate (also known as tripotassium citrate) is a potassium salt of citric acid. It is a white, hygroscopic crystalline powder. It is odorless with a saline taste. It contains 38.3% potassium by mass. In the monohydrate form it is highly hygroscopic and deliquescent.
Potassium citrate is used to treat a kidney stone condition called renal tubular acidosis. Potassium Citrate is indicated also for the management of Hypocitraturic calcium oxalate nephrolithiasis.

Metabolisme

Potassium Citrate is absorbed and the citrate is metabolised to bicarbonate.

Rute Eliminasi

Urinary; less than 5% unchanged.

Interaksi Makanan

1 Data
  • 1. Take with food. Take potassium citrate within 30 minutes of eating to limit gastrointestinal irritation.
